Publisher's summary

Awareness grows... The gathering commences.... The world has changed. Jack Walker and the other survivors must adjust with it if they are to have a chance. They've managed to stay one step ahead so far but the gap is narrowing. The night runners are growing and adapting. The rules are changing. Winter is coming and the survivors must ready themselves for the long season. With Robert and Bri rescued from captivity, Jack focuses on the days ahead. His mind weighs on ensuring their supplies will see them through and clearing the night runners away from their sanctuary. There are changes in the air that threaten not only the safety of the small band of survivors, but perhaps the entire remnants of mankind. The deadliest threats Are those that build unseen...Book I - A New World:Chaos, Book II - A New World: Return, Book III - A New World: Sanctuary, Book IV - A New World: Taken, Book V - A New World: Awakening, Book VI - A New World: Dissension, Book VII - A New World: Takedown, Book VIII - A New World: Conspiracy Book IX - A New World: Reckoning

My Book 3 Review was meant for this Book.

Is there anything you would change about this book?

Hearing the Night Runners side of the story, It takes away from the Survival Horror element.

Would you recommend Awakening: A New World, Book 5 to your friends? Why or why not?

Yes, overall good story and character building just some things make you shake your head

What three words best describe Mark Gagliardi’s performance?

To Cartoonish

If this book were a movie would you go see it?

Yes, if the director took away the Night runners Mental ability and turn them back to the scary mindless predators they started out as

Any additional comments?

The Author needs to know when he has a good story and work this that but adding mental abilities to the Night Runners (talking and sending pictures with their mind) stocking up on Supermarket supplies, and two night runners all of a sudden becoming more intelligent and aware and controlling other night runners is plain silly. and is taking away from the good story he built. Night Runners coming with no thought no reason but just to devour you is way scarier.
